生物质热解液与壳聚糖处理对圣女果保鲜效果的影响

摘    要:为了提高生物质资源利用率,开发低毒无害的新型果蔬保鲜剂,进行了3.3%生物质热解液以及热解液和不同浓度(0.50、0.75、1.00 g/L)的壳聚糖复合涂被液处理对圣女果保鲜效果的研究,主要观察了多聚半乳糖醛酸酶(PG)、过氧化物酶(POD)和多酚氧化酶(PPO)的活性及相关物质含量的变化。结果表明:生物质热解液与壳聚糖复合可较好地抑制圣女果PG和PPO活性的增长并减缓POD活性的下降速率,同时可减缓可溶性果胶和过氧化氢含量的增长并延缓酚类物质含量的下降,说明生物质热解液与壳聚糖复合涂被液处理有利于圣女果的贮藏与保鲜。

Effect of Biomass Pyrolysis Liquid and Chitosan on Fresh Keeping of Cherry Tomatoes
Abstract:To improve the utilization rate of biomass resources and develop a new type of fruit and vegetable preservative with low toxicity and harmless, the fresh keeping effect of 3.3% biomass pyrolysis liquid and compound coating solution of biomass pyrolysis liquid and different concentrations(0.50, 0.75, 1.00 g/L) of chitosan on cherry tomatoes was studied. The changes of polygalacturonase(PG), peroxidase(POD), polyphenol oxidase(PPO) activities and the related substances were mainly observed. The results showed that the compound agent of biomass pyrolysis liquid and chitosan could inhibit the increase of PG and PPO activities, retard the decline rate of POD activity, at the same time, slow down the increase of soluble pectin and hydrogen peroxide contents and the decrease of phenols, which illustrated that the treatment by compound coating solution of biomass pyrolysis liquid and chitosan was beneficial to the storage and fresh keeping of cherry tomatoes.
